Global Quantum Key Distribution (QKD) Market Overview 

The global Quantum Key Distribution (QKD) market is emerging as a critical segment within advanced cybersecurity, driven by the need for ultra-secure communication in the age of quantum computing. The market was valued at approximately USD 420 million in 2025 and is projected to reach around USD 2860 million by 2032, growing at a CAGR of over 31.62% during the forecast period.

Market growth is being fueled by the rising concerns over data security and the potential threat posed by quantum computers to traditional encryption methods. QKD leverages the principles of quantum mechanics to enable secure key exchange, ensuring that any attempt at interception is immediately detectable. This makes it a highly attractive solution for protecting sensitive data across critical industries.

Quantum key distribution involves the use of quantum states—typically photons—to securely transmit encryption keys between parties. As digital infrastructure becomes more complex and cyber threats evolve, QKD is increasingly recognized as a future-proof security solution for sectors such as finance, defense, telecommunications, and government.

The market is transitioning from experimental deployments to early-stage commercialization, supported by advancements in quantum technologies, fiber-optic networks, and satellite-based communication systems. Governments and enterprises are investing heavily in quantum-safe cryptography and secure communication frameworks.

Key Market Drivers

Rising Threat of Quantum Computing 
The development of quantum computers poses a significant risk to conventional cryptographic systems such as RSA and ECC. These systems could be broken by quantum algorithms, making secure communication vulnerable.

QKD provides a quantum-resistant alternative, ensuring long-term data security. This urgency is driving investments in quantum-safe technologies, particularly among governments and financial institutions.

Increasing Cybersecurity Concerns 
The growing frequency of sophisticated cyberattacks and data breaches is pushing organizations to adopt stronger encryption methods. QKD offers unparalleled security by enabling theoretically unbreakable encryption keys.

Sectors handling highly sensitive data—such as defense, banking, and healthcare—are leading adopters of QKD solutions.

Government Initiatives and Funding 
Governments worldwide are investing in quantum communication infrastructure as part of national security strategies. Large-scale projects, including quantum networks and satellite-based QKD systems, are accelerating market growth.

National programs in regions such as North America, Europe, and Asia Pacific are supporting research, development, and deployment of QKD technologies.

Advancements in Quantum Communication Infrastructure 
Technological progress in fiber optics, photonics, and satellite communication is enabling practical QKD deployment over longer distances.

The integration of QKD with existing telecom infrastructure is expanding its applicability, making it more commercially viable.

Core Market Segmentation

By Component 
The market is segmented into hardware, software, and services.

  • Hardware includes photon sources, detectors, quantum random number generators, and optical components. 
  • Software includes encryption management platforms, key management systems, and network control software. 
  • Services such as consulting, integration, and maintenance are gaining importance as organizations require specialized expertise. 

By Type 
QKD technologies are categorized into:

  • Fiber-Based QKD 
  • Free-Space QKD 
  • Satellite-Based QKD 

Fiber-based QKD currently dominates due to established infrastructure, while satellite-based QKD is rapidly gaining traction for long-distance communication.

Market Restraints and Challenges

High implementation costs remain a significant barrier to widespread adoption. QKD systems require specialized hardware, infrastructure, and expertise, making them expensive for many organizations.

Limited transmission distance and scalability challenges also hinder adoption, particularly for fiber-based QKD systems. While satellite-based solutions address this issue, they involve substantial investment and technical complexity.

Additionally, the lack of standardization and interoperability between different QKD systems poses integration challenges.

Emerging Opportunities

Satellite-Based QKD Expansion 
Satellite-based QKD is emerging as a game-changer, enabling secure communication over global distances. This technology is expected to play a key role in building global quantum communication networks.

Integration with Post-Quantum Cryptography (PQC) 
Combining QKD with post-quantum cryptographic algorithms offers a layered security approach, enhancing resilience against both classical and quantum attacks.

Growth in Financial and Telecom Sectors 
Banks and telecom operators are increasingly adopting QKD to secure transactions, customer data, and network infrastructure, creating significant growth opportunities.

Development of Quantum Networks 
The evolution of quantum internet and secure communication networks is expected to drive long-term demand for QKD technologies.

Regional Insights

North America 
North America leads the market, driven by strong government funding, advanced research infrastructure, and early adoption of quantum technologies.

Europe 
Europe is focusing on building secure quantum communication networks, supported by collaborative initiatives and regulatory frameworks.

Asia Pacific 
Asia Pacific is the fastest-growing region, with significant investments in countries like China, Japan, and India. China, in particular, is leading in satellite-based QKD deployment.

Latin America 
Latin America is in the early stages of adoption, with growing interest in secure communication solutions for financial and government sectors.

Middle East and Africa 
This region is witnessing gradual growth, driven by investments in cybersecurity and digital infrastructure modernization.

Competitive Landscape

The QKD market is highly specialized and competitive, involving quantum technology firms, telecom providers, and cybersecurity companies.

Key players are focusing on innovation, partnerships, and large-scale pilot projects to gain a competitive edge. Collaboration between academia, industry, and governments is playing a crucial role in advancing QKD technologies.
